Transarterial Embolization of Intracranial Arteriovenous Fistulas with Large Venous Pouches in the Form of Venous Outlet Ectasia and Large Venous Varix or Aneurysm : Two Centers Experience

  • Objective : There are different types of cerebral vascular malformations. Pial arteriovenous fistulas (PAVFs) and dural arteriovenous fistulas (DAVFs) are two entities; they consist of one or more arterial connections to a single venous outlet without a true intervening nidus. The high turbulent flow of PAVFs and aggressive DAVFs with cortical venous reflux can result in venous outflow varix and aneurysmal dilatation. They pose a significant challenge to transvenous embolization (TVE), stereotactic radiosurgery, and surgical treatment. We aim to share our centers' experience with the transarterial embolization (TAE) for arteriovenous fistulas (AVFs) with large venous pouches and to report the outcome. Methods : The authors' two institutions' databases were retrospectively reviewed from February 2017 to February 2021. All patients with intracranial high flow PAVFs and aggressive DAVFs with venous outlet ectasia and large venous varix and were treated by TAE were included. Results : Fifteen patients harboring 11 DAVFs and four PAVFs met our inclusion criteria. All patients underwent TAE in 17 sessions. Complete angiographic obliteration was achieved after 14 sessions in 12 patients (80%). Four patients (25%) had residual after one TAE session. Technical failure was documented in one patient (6.7%). Fourteen patients (93.3%) had favorable functional outcome (modified Rankin score 0-2). Conclusions : TAE for high flow or aggressive intracranial AVFs is a safe and considerable treatment option, especially for those associated with large venous pouches that are challenging and relatively high-risk for TVE.

Identification of Differentially-Methylated Genes and Pathways in Patients with Delayed Cerebral Ischemia Following Subarachnoid Hemorrhage

  • Objective : We reported the differentially methylated genes in patients with subarachnoid hemorrhage (SAH) using bioinformatics analyses to explore the biological characteristics of the development of delayed cerebral ischemia (DCI). Methods : DNA methylation profiles obtained from 40 SAH patients from an epigenome-wide association study were analyzed. Functional enrichment analysis, protein-protein interaction (PPI) network, and module analyses were carried out. Results : A total of 13 patients (32.5%) experienced DCI during the follow-up. In total, we categorized the genes into the two groups of hypermethylation (n=910) and hypomethylation (n=870). The hypermethylated genes referred to biological processes of organic cyclic compound biosynthesis, nucleobase-containing compound biosynthesis, heterocycle biosynthesis, aromatic compound biosynthesis and cellular nitrogen compound biosynthesis. The hypomethylated genes referred to biological processes of carbohydrate metabolism, the regulation of cell size, and the detection of a stimulus, and molecular functions of amylase activity, and hydrolase activity. Based on PPI network and module analysis, three hypermethylation modules were mainly associated with antigen-processing, Golgi-to-ER retrograde transport, and G alpha (i) signaling events, and two hypomethylation modules were associated with post-translational protein phosphorylation and the regulation of natural killer cell chemotaxis. VHL, KIF3A, KIFAP3, RACGAP1, and OPRM1 were identified as hub genes for hypermethylation, and ALB and IL5 as hub genes for hypomethylation. Conclusion : This study provided novel insights into DCI pathogenesis following SAH. Differently methylated hub genes can be useful biomarkers for the accurate DCI diagnosis.

Ruptured pseudoaneurysm of the internal maxillary artery in zygomaticomaxillary fracture: a case report

  • Post-traumatic pseudoaneurysms of internal maxillary artery are rare, but may be life-threatening. When arterial damage leads to pseudoaneurysm formation, delayed intractable epistaxis can occur. We report our experience with the diagnosis and management of a ruptured internal maxillary arterial pseudoaneurysm that was discovered preoperatively in a patient with a zygomaticomaxillary complex (ZMC) fracture. He presented to the emergency room with epistaxis, which ceased shortly, and sinus hemorrhage was observed with a fracture of the posterior maxillary wall. The patient was scheduled for open reduction and internal fixation (ORIF) of the ZMC fracture. However, immediately before surgery, uncontrolled epistaxis of unknown origin was observed. Angiography indicated a pseudoaneurysm of the posterior superior alveolar artery. Selective endovascular embolization was performed, and hemostasis was achieved. After radiologic intervention, ORIF was successfully implemented without complications. Our case shows that in patients with a posterior maxillary wall fracture, there is a risk of uncontrolled bleeding in the perioperative period that could be caused by pseudoaneurysms, which should be considered even in the absence of typical symptoms.

Intrathecal administration of naringenin improves motor dysfunction and neuropathic pain following compression spinal cord injury in rats: relevance to its antioxidant and anti-inflammatory activities

  • Background: Spinal cord injury (SCI) is one of the most debilitating disorders throughout the world, causing persistent sensory-motor dysfunction, with no effective treatment. Oxidative stress and inflammatory responses play key roles in the secondary phase of SCI. Naringenin (NAR) is a natural flavonoid with known anti-inflammatory and antioxidative properties. This study aims at evaluating the effects of intrathecal NAR administration on sensory-motor disability after SCI. Methods: Animals underwent a severe compression injury using an aneurysm clip. About 30 minutes after surgery, NAR was injected intrathecally at the doses of 5, 10, and 15 mM in 20 µL volumes. For the assessment of neuropathic pain and locomotor function, acetone drop, hot plate, inclined plane, and Basso, Beattie, Bresnahan tests were carried out weekly till day 28 post-SCI. Effects of NAR on matrix metalloproteinase (MMP)-2 and MMP-9 activity was appraised by gelatin zymography. Also, histopathological analyses and serum levels of glutathione (GSH), catalase and nitrite were measured in different groups. Results: NAR reduced neuropathic pain, improved locomotor function, and also attenuated SCI-induced weight loss weekly till day 28 post-SCI. Zymography analysis showed that NAR suppressed MMP-9 activity, whereas it increased that of MMP-2, indicating its anti-neuroinflammatory effects. Also, intrathecal NAR modified oxidative stress related markers GSH, catalase, and nitrite levels. Besides, the neuroprotective effect of NAR was corroborated through increased survival of sensory and motor neurons after SCI. Conclusions: These results suggest intrathecal NAR as a promising candidate for medical therapeutics for SCI-induced sensory and motor dysfunction.

Frontotemporal Craniotomy for Clipping of Unruptured Aneurysm Using a Diamond-Coated Thread Wire Saw and Reconstruction Using Calcium Phosphate Cement without Metal Fixation

  • Metal fixation systems for cranial bone flaps cut by a drill are convenient devices for cranioplasty, but cause several complications. We use modified craniotomy using a fine diamond-coated threadwire saw (diamond T-saw) to reduce the bone defect, and osteoplasty calcium phosphate cement without metal fixation. We report our outcomes and tips of this method. A total of 78 consecutive patients underwent elective frontotemporal craniotomy for clipping of unruptured intracranial aneurysms between 2015 and 2019. The follow-up periods ranged from 13 to 66 months. The bone fixation state was evaluated by bone computed tomography (CT) and three-dimensional CT (3D-CT). The diamond T-saw could minimize the bone defect. Only one wound infection occurred within 1 week postoperatively, and no late infection. No pain, palpable/cosmetically noticeable displacement of the bone flap, fluid accumulations, or other complications were observed. The condition of bone fixation and the cosmetic efficacy were thoroughly satisfactory for all patients, and bone CT and 3D-CT demonstrated that good bone fusion. No complication typical of metal fixation occurred. Our method is technically easy and safety, and achieved good mid-term bone flap fixation in the mid-term course, so has potential for bone fixation without the use of metal plates.

Morphology of middle cerebral artery using computed tomography angiographic study in a tertiary care hospital

  • Increased tortuosity of vessel is associated with high incidence of plaque formation leading to atherosclerosis. Surgical procedures are done after analyzing morphology of middle cerebral artery (MCA). However, literature describing MCA morphology using computed tomography angiography (CTA) is limited, so this study was planned to determine its incidence in Indian population. Datasets of CTA from 289 patients (180 males and 109 females), average age: 49.29±16.16 years (range: 11 to 85 years), from a tertiary care hospital were systematically reviewed for morphology of MCA. Cases involving aneurysms and infarcts were excluded. Four shapes of MCA were recognized: straight, U, inverted U, and S-shaped. MCA was straight in 44% (254/578), U-shaped in 37% (215/578), S shaped in 15% (89/578) and inverted U-shaped in 3% (20/578) cases. In males, MCA was straight in 46% (166/360), U-shaped in 37% (134/360), S-shaped in 16% (58/360) and inverted U-shaped in 4% (14/360) cases. In females, MCA was straight in 42% cases (92/218), U-shaped in 37% (81/218), S-shaped in 17% (36/218) and inverted U-shaped in 4% (9/218). On comparing shape with various age groups using chi square test, U shaped (P≤0.001) and S-shaped (P=0.003) MCA were found to be statistically significant. The incidence of straight shape was higher in advanced age group (>60 years). Knowledge of MCA shape will be useful for clinicians and surgeons in successful endovascular recanalization. Also, this data would help surgeons during neurointerventional procedures.

뇌동맥류의 혈관 내 치료: 코일색전술의 기술적 선택 (Endovascular Treatment of Cerebral Aneurysms: Technical Options in Coil Embolization)

  • 뇌동맥류 치료에 있어 분리형 코일을 이용한 혈관 내 치료는 여러 기법의 발전으로 말미암아 그 임상적용 빈도가 수술적 치료의 빈도를 능가하여 뇌동맥류의 주된 치료 방법으로 자리 잡게 되었다. 혈관 내 치료의 임상적용이 확대된 데에는 기존 코일색전술이 가진 기술적 제한점을 극복할 수 있는 여러 치료기법들의 개발에 기인한 것인데, 특히 광경동맥류를 치료할 수 있는 여러 방법이 고안되었고, 그중에서 보조적인 기구를 함께 사용하는 여러 기법이 개발되어 사용되고 있다. 이 방법들은 치료의 과정에서 동맥류 내에 삽입되는 코일의 일부가 모동맥으로 빠져나오는 것을 방지하는 기법들이며, 기술적 난이도와 시술에 따른 위험도는 각 기법에 따라, 또한 병변과 주변 혈관의 양상에 따라 서로 달라서 상황에 따라 적절한 기법을 선택할 필요가 있으며, 원칙적으로 위험도가 가장 낮은 기법을 먼저 선택하여 시도하는 것인 바람직하다. 본 기고에서는 일반적인 뇌동맥류에서 혈관 내 치료의 기본적인 기법인 코일색전술에서, 기술적 제한점을 극복하는 여러 가지 보조적인 기법과 그 기술적 응용 및 주의점에 대하여 검토하고자 한다.

복부 대동맥에 발생한 동맥-요관 누공의 혈관 내 치료: 증례 보고와 문헌고찰 (Endovascular Treatment for Arterioureteral Fistula of the Abdominal Aorta: A Case Report and Literature Review)

  • 저자들은 복부 대동맥에 발생한 동맥-요관루를 혈관 내 접근을 통해 성공적으로 치료할 수 있었던 드문 증례를 보고하는 바이다. 동맥-요관루는 극히 드물지만, 사망률이 7~23%에 이르는 치명적인 질환이다. 저혈량쇼크와 같은 치명적 합병증을 예방하기 위해서는 조기 진단과 함께 즉각적인 치료가 필수적이다. 하지만 질환 자체가 희귀하고 민감도가 높은 검사 방법이 없기 때문에, 진단을 위해서는 높은 수준의 임상적 의심이 반드시 필요하다. 복강 내 수술, 방사선 치료 및 요관 스텐트의 장기 설치 등의 특징적인 과거력을 가진 환자에서 외상적 사건이 동맥-요관루 발생의 촉발 요인이 될 수 있다. 복부 대동맥에 발생한 동맥-요관루 환자에서도 혈관 내 인조혈관 스텐트의 삽입은 효과적인 치료 방법이다.

Klebsiella oxytoca에 의한 간농양 내 거짓동맥류: 증례 보고 (Liver Abscess Caused by Klebsiella oxytoca with Hepatic Artery Pseudoaneurysm: A Case Report)

  • 간동맥 거짓동맥류는 드문 질환이나 잠재적으로 생명을 위협할 수 있는 질환으로 외상 이후에 발생하는 경우가 많다. 때문에 빠른 진단과 적절한 치료가 혈복강과 같은 심각한 결과를 예방하기 위해 필수적이다. 우리는 의인적 손상 없이 Klebsiella oxytoca에 의한 간농양에 생긴 간동맥 거짓동맥류의 드문 증례를 보고하는 바이다. 이 증례의 독특한 특징은 농양 공간이 간동맥과 생긴 누공에 의해 거짓동맥류가 되었다는 점이다. 이 증례로부터 의인성 손상이 없이 환자의 임상 과정이 좋지 않은 경우 혈관 관련 합병증에 주의를 기울여야 함을 알 수 있으며 혈관 내 시술의 효과적이고 안전한 치료 방법이 될 수 있음을 알 수 있다.

동맥류와 혈전성 폐색이 동반된 양측 잔류좌골동맥: 증례 보고 (Bilateral Persistent Sciatic Arteries Complicated with Aneurysmal Dilatation and Thrombotic Occlusion: A Case Report)

  • 양측 잔류좌골동맥은 드문 선천성 혈관 기형으로 동맥류를 잘 동반하며, 이는 사례의 40~61%에서 발생한다. 본 증례는 알코올성 간경화가 있는 70세 남자에서 발생한 좌골동맥 잔존의 1예이다. 간경화와 관련된 응고 병증으로 인한 대퇴부 출혈을 평가하기 위해 시행한 컴퓨터단층사진 혈관조영술 검사에서 양측 완전 좌골동맥 잔존이 우연히 발견되었다. 환자는 선택적 좌측 잔류좌골동맥 혈관조영술에서 좌측 잔류좌골동맥의 동맥류 및 혈전성 폐색이 있어 흡인 혈전제거술로 혈전 부분 제거를 시행하였으며 심부 대퇴 동맥의 경험적 혈관조영색전술을 통해 대퇴근육 내 출혈을 성공적으로 치료하였다.
